Output 3cb389b4372b95442f8c809a10ac6c1d45413ffdb3ef9655cae95b9ef8ab899a:8

value
1029412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b737c8174c28b2897bc0e82910ada49d9b20cf2 OP_EQUAL
address
3EQNCLhchkpafMrbNEsAYL6JXTnzcFgTXG
transaction
3cb389b4372b95442f8c809a10ac6c1d45413ffdb3ef9655cae95b9ef8ab899a
spent
true